The Creative Execution
Beem's visual identity lives in a digital interface — playful iconography, bold colour, the instant social energy of money moving between people. The challenge was translating that into a physical world without losing what made it feel alive.
We layered Beem's signature digital illustrations directly into the photography — the app's interface bleeding into the urban environment, the boundary between screen and street made deliberately ambiguous. Movement as the visual logic throughout: staff in motion, the city in motion, reflecting the instantaneous nature of the product itself.
The industrial textures of Wynyard — concrete, steel, the mid-morning energy of the CBD — provided contrast against the merchandise's bold, playful register. High-energy without being loud.
